The Ultimate Guide to Los Angeles Oversized T-Shirts: Embracing Comfort and Style
In the bustling fashion scene of Los Angeles, where trends are born and style is a way of life, oversized T-shirts have emerged as a wardrobe staple that effortlessly combines comfort and trendiness. These roomy garments not only provide a relaxed fit but also make a bold fashion statement that reflects the laid-back yet chic vibe of the city. In this guide, we'll delve into the world of Los Angeles Oversized T Shirt, exploring their origins, styling tips, and why they've become a must-have item for fashion enthusiasts.
The Origin of Oversized T-Shirts in Los Angeles
Los Angeles, known for its diverse and influential fashion culture, has played a pivotal role in popularizing oversized T-shirts. The trend originated in the streetwear scene, where comfort meets edgy aesthetics. Influenced by the casual lifestyle of the city and the need for versatile clothing, oversized T-shirts quickly became a go-to choice for Angelenos.
Embracing Comfort without Compromising Style
One of the key reasons behind the widespread adoption of oversized T-shirts in Los Angeles is their unparalleled comfort. The loose fit allows for unrestricted movement, making them perfect for the city's active lifestyle. Whether you're strolling along Venice Beach, exploring the Arts District, or hitting the vibrant nightlife, an oversized tee effortlessly transitions from day to night.
However, comfort doesn't mean compromising style. Los Angeles oversized T-shirts come in a variety of designs, colors, and prints, allowing wearers to express their individuality. From iconic graphics representing the city's landmarks to subtle yet sophisticated patterns, these tees can be styled in countless ways to suit different occasions.
Styling Tips for Los Angeles Oversized T-Shirts
Effortless Street Style: Embrace the streetwear vibe by pairing your oversized tee with distressed denim, sneakers, and a stylish backpack. Add a cap or sunglasses for an extra touch of cool.
Chic Athleisure Look: Combine comfort and style by teaming your oversized T-shirt with high-waisted leggings or biker shorts. Complete the look with trendy sneakers and accessorize with a crossbody bag.
Versatile Layering: Use your oversized tee as a layering piece. Throw it over a bodycon dress or wear it as a tunic with leggings. Experiment with different textures and lengths for a fashion-forward ensemble.
Casual Elegance: Elevate your oversized T-shirt with tailored bottoms like wide-leg trousers or a midi skirt. Finish the look with heeled boots or stylish sandals for a casual yet polished appearance.
Where to Find the Best Los Angeles Oversized T-Shirts
When it comes to sourcing the perfect oversized tee, Los Angeles offers a myriad of options. Explore local boutiques, vintage shops, and streetwear stores in neighborhoods like Melrose Avenue, Silver Lake, and Downtown LA. Additionally, many online retailers curate collections that capture the essence of Los Angeles style, making it easier for fashion enthusiasts worldwide to embrace this trend.
